Our River and Watershed
The Santa Fe River Watershed spans over 180,000 acres (285 square miles), encompassing the Santa Fe River and all its contributing streams, arroyos, and watercourses. Within the City of Santa Fe, the watershed collects water flowing from open spaces, streets, parking lots, buildings, and residential areas. Essentially, all water within this area drains into and becomes part of the interconnected river system and watershed. Recognizing the importance of this resource, the City, led by the River and Watershed Section of the Public Works Department is implementing a wide array of initiatives aimed at enhancing the health and functionality of the river and its broader watershed.
Santa Fe receives most of its rainfall during intense and infrequent precipitation events. Impervious or hardened surfaces cause water to move quickly across the landscape, instead of infiltrating into the soil. As runoff travels across these surfaces, collects trash and pollutants before entering our waterways impacting surface water quality. Because these smooth surfaces lack natural obstructions to slow or spread the water, runoff moves faster and with enough power to cause significant erosion.

Reducing Pollution in Urban Runoff
The City of Santa Fe is required by the Environmental Protection Agency (EPA) to hold a Municipal Separate Storm Sewer System (MS4) permit to discharge stormwater runoff into waterways. This program mandates that the City implement a comprehensive Stormwater Management Plan (SWMP), ensuring that pollutants found in urban runoff are reduced before entering our local arroyos and the Santa Fe River.
The City manages flood control and stormwater conveyance infrastructure such as culverts, bridges, inlets, pipes, as well as our natural conveyance channels like arroyos and the Santa Fe River. The River & Watershed Section, along with the Complete Streets Division, is tasked with assessing, managing, and funding repair projects that help maintain the stability and health of these vital conveyances, ensuring their continued function for the city.

Green Infrastructure
Using Nature to Manage Stormwater
The City of Santa Fe has long been an innovator of Green Stormwater Infrastructure (GSI) looking at a landscape-wide approach to stormwater management in areas within parks, rights of way, and open spaces to infiltrate and clean stormwater before it enters local waterways.
The City prioritizes stormwater infiltration on all Public Works projects. These projects manage stormwater at the source by encouraging runoff to slow, spread, and sink as it moves across the landscape. These sites infiltrate and treat over two million gallons of stormwater per year and provide many other benefits including: erosion control, wildlife habitat, pollution reduction, shade, and natural beauty.
As part of this effort, the City has several large-scale innovative projects underway that will help recharge the landscape, infiltrate stormwater to local low-lying aquifers, provide dual purpose spaces for recreation, and promote biodiversity and habitat in our urban scape.

Highlighted Project: Ashbaugh Park Stormwater Infiltration
The purpose of this project is to address flooding in the Cerrillos Road corridor and surrounding neighborhoods by capturing, detaining, and infiltrating stormwater in Ashbaugh Park. The project will route flow into the northern portion of Ashbaugh and install a large-scale infiltration gallery with capacity to store water underground, while providing new park amenities for the community.
This new design will provide educational opportunities related to water resource management that highlight the social, cultural, and historical importance of the Acequia Madre. It will also decrease pollutant loads at the point of discharge into the Arroyo de San Antonio and Santa Fe River and support locally adapted plants, which in turn provide habitat for local wildlife and contribute to greater urban biodiversity.
In plain language, the project will reduce flooding by collecting stormwater, temporarily holding it, and allowing it to soak into the ground.

Highlighted Project: Marc Brandt Park Stormwater Drainage Improvements
Like the Ashbaugh Park Project, this project looks to improve the conveyance of storm flows through Marc Brandt Park while providing infiltrating surface storage in the upper portion of the park and a piped conveyance through the lower portion of the park that will act as a regional flood control by attenuating peak discharge downstream. This park will deliver multiple benefits including upgraded park amenities such as seating and gathering areas and improved pollinator habitat.
In plain language: The project will help manage stormwater and reduce flooding by slowing, storing, soaking in, and safely moving rainwater through the park.

Rain Gardens
Rain gardens are a great tool for capturing and filtering stormwater. They allow water to slowly infiltrate into the ground, keeping pollutants out of the Santa Fe River. Rain gardens also help us recharge Santa Fe's shallow aquifers. The City and its partners, including the Santa Fe Watershed Association and Keep Santa Fe Beautiful, have built over 20 rain gardens since 2012. You may have parked near one at Herb Martinez Park or walked past our newest rain garden on East Alameda without noticing, but these gardens are capturing and treating over half a million gallons of stormwater per year, according to SFWA.

Runoff to Roots Program
As supporters of green stormwater infrastructure innovation, the City’s River and Watershed Program recently launched its Runoff to Roots Program (2026) which expands the efforts of the Alameda Rain Garden Program to areas beyond the Alameda road corridor.
The Runoff to Roots Program supports neighborhoods and individuals that wish to install rain gardens in public spaces such as city parks, open spaces, and rights of way. These rain gardens can collect and infiltrate stormwater runoff from impervious areas to improve water quality, attenuate peak runoff volumes, increase biodiversity, and decrease urban heat islands. The City of Santa Fe will help design, install, and fund these projects, while volunteers commit to maintaining the facility.

Partnership Highlight: Siringo Rain Garden Control Study
The City of Santa Fe’s River and Watershed Section, in collaboration with the University of New Mexico Biology Department and The Rain Catcher Inc., has helped launch a pilot study to inform how the city manages stormwater. Five specialized rain garden basins have been installed along Siringo Road, between Pacheco Street and Calle Contendo.
The two-year study aims to determine how effectively these rain gardens enhance ground water recharge, and how long they retain moisture to support urban vegetation through passive irrigation at various depths. To ensure the accuracy of the hydrological data, the basins will remain vegetation-free during the initial monitoring period. Once the data collection is complete, the basins will be planted with trees, shrubs, and fungi suited to the observed moisture conditions. This study will serve as a blueprint for future rain gardens throughout the city and helping inform how landscapes are designed and managed across the City parks and open spaces. Because urban stormwater carries with it various toxins and pollutants, further studies will be conducted to track these pollutants which will facilitate continued research in bioremediation efforts throughout the city as well.

Partnership Highlight: Mary Esther Gonzales Senior Center
The City’s Parks and Open Space Division collaborated with constituents and visitors of the Senior Center to install a series of rain garden basins to collect roof runoff that would otherwise flow directly to the parking lot. Instead, these rain gardens will slow and sink roof runoff into the landscape providing passive water harvesting and irrigation for newly planted vegetation. City staff also worked with seniors to decorate the birdhouses planted throughout the site to provide nesting for local species.
